There is no fixed standard for the customs clearance agency fees for imported rough blocks, as they are affected by multiple factors. Firstly, for the value of the goods, a basic agency fee is generally charged at a certain percentage of the goods value, such as around 0.5% - 2%. Secondly, the quantity, weight, and volume of the goods affect transportation and handling fees, and the fees will increase accordingly with a large quantity.

Furthermore, different customs clearance ports have different charges, and some busy or special ports have higher fees. In addition, whether the documents are complete and whether special regulatory conditions are involved also affect the fees. Common customs clearance agency fee items include customs declaration fees, inspection fees, port miscellaneous fees, warehousing fees, etc. Overall, for ordinary imported rough blocks, when the documents are complete and there are no special regulatory requirements, the customs clearance agency fee per ticket may range from 2000 to 8000 yuan. Specifically, it still needs to be discussed in detail with the agent in combination with the actual situation.

The customs clearance agency fees for imported rough blocks are related to the service content of the agency company you choose. Some only handle customs declaration, and the fees are relatively lower. If the whole - process services such as transportation and warehousing are included, the fees will be higher. For example, the basic customs declaration fee may be a few hundred yuan, and the total cost with other miscellaneous fees depends on the specific situation.
